Workshop

BOLO

December 3 – 5, 2019
Duration: 2 hours The laboratory is free and open to people over 18 for a maximum of 10 people. It is possible to book for one or more days by writing to visiteguidate@triennale.org by Friday 29 November.
From conception to design, up to the reproduction of the project, experimenting with analog post-production through distortion, enlargement, reduction and collage. Among assorted old and new images, with mouths, ears, noses and eyes with strange features, the participants will be guided, through analogical processes such as photocopy printing, in the conception and realization of fanzines to keep with them. Participants are invited to contribute by bringing with them magazines, photographs or newspaper clippings related to the topics Speak Listen Watch Make.
